Cultivating Green Sweet Peppers: A Planting Handbook
Easily raising delicious green sweet produce requires several basic procedures. Start with selecting a bright spot that receives at minimum six to eight times of daytime light. Rich ground is vital; amend it with humus to offer needed vitamins. Selecting the Ideal Green Bell Pepper
To obtain a flavorful green pepper, consider these easy choosing tips. Find peppers that appear firm and heavy for their size. Don't pick any that display yielding spots or shriveling. A vibrant, deep green color generally implies peak readiness. While green peppers are typically harvested before they change color, a little yellowing can still mean they're prepared for consumption. Don't be hesitant to gently press the pepper – it should offer slight resistance slightly when pressed.
